A GUIDE TO FORGING PARTS

Forging stands as a timeless and esteemed art, seamlessly blending with modern metalworking practices to demonstrate its unrivaled importance. At its core, forging artfully transforms raw metal while maintaining its robust integrity. Masterful artisans utilize advanced techniques, including hammering, rolling, and pressing, to exquisitely shape materials. This intricate process, powered by intense heat, enables the elegant manipulation of metal, providing a remarkable array of forging methods, each boasting unique benefits and applications.

When compared to casting and other metalworking techniques, forging emerges as the ultimate choice for creating components with extraordinary physical properties, renowned for unmatched tensile strength and exceptional cost-efficiency. The key to these superior results lies in the strategic manipulation of the metal's grain structure. By skillfully bypassing melting, a combination of impactful and compressive forces is applied to direct the grain structure, perfectly aligning it with the finished product's design. This meticulous process results in components that offer significantly enhanced strength compared to their machined or cast counterparts.

A COMPREHENSIVE EXPLORATION OF THE FORGING PROCESS

Within the vast realm of forging, numerous specialized subtypes exist, each distinguished by its intricate process details. Yet, the majority of forging ventures adhere to a fundamental sequence of steps that ensures success and precision.

  • The triumph of forging lies in the intricately crafted dies that mold and compress metal into specific shapes. Choosing the right toolset is crucial for achieving the desired form. Custom die designs are often indispensable to meet precise specifications, especially in large-scale production runs where multiple dies synchronize tasks like flattening, forming, and cutting with unparalleled precision.
  • Following meticulous planning and precision toolmaking, the transformative journey of metalworking begins. Initially, the workpiece, or billet, is cut to exact dimensions, then heated to the precise temperature essential for effective molding.
  • At this critical juncture, forging methodologies can vary significantly. Depending on the method selected, the heated billet may be placed between dies or into a preformed cavity for compression. Alternatively, in cold forging, the billet remains at room temperature and is shaped through manual hammering techniques to achieve the desired form with precision.
  • For optimal outcomes, certain finishing touches may be required. For instance, some dies produce excess material known as flashing, which must be carefully trimmed to ensure a flawless final product.
COLD FORGING VS HOT FORGING

 

Forging, an ancient and constantly progressing art, gracefully divides into two primary techniques: hot forging and cold forging. These distinct approaches masterfully transform raw metal into resilient, high-quality products that epitomize the pinnacle of precision metalwork.

Hot forging is a highly sophisticated process that involves heating the metal beyond its recrystallization point, reaching an intense 2,300 degrees Fahrenheit. This method is acclaimed for its outstanding energy efficiency in metal shaping, due to the diminished yield strength and improved ductility. Additionally, it effectively eliminates chemical inconsistencies, ensuring a consistently uniform metal composition throughout the entire forged product.

Cold forging, in contrast, precisely reshapes metals at ambient temperature or just above, testing their strength and durability. Although more resistant metals like high-carbon steel can be challenging, cold forging is renowned for its unmatched precision, achieving remarkable dimensional accuracy, consistent uniformity, and an outstanding surface finish. This versatile technique includes bending, extruding, cold drawing, and cold heading, necessitating sophisticated equipment and sometimes intermediate annealing.

What Is Hot Forging?

Hot forging is an advanced and innovative process where metal is heated beyond its recrystallization point. This reduces flow stress and energy use, significantly boosting production speeds. It simplifies the metal shaping process and drastically reduces fracture risks during manufacturing, making it an indispensable technique in contemporary metalworking.

Iron and its alloys are predominantly hot forged due to two pivotal reasons: Firstly, as work hardening progresses, these durable materials, such as steel and iron, become increasingly resistant to forming. Secondly, hot forging these metals is economically advantageous, allowing for subsequent heat treatments that fortify strength without solely depending on cold working methods.

The typical temperature ranges for hot forging are: Aluminum (Al) Alloys range from 360°C (680°F) to 520°C (968°F); Copper (Cu) Alloys necessitate 700°C (1,292°F) to 800°C (1,472°F); Steel is forged at temperatures soaring to 1,150°C (2,102°F).

 
 
 

How are Hot Forgings Made?

In the hot forging process, metals are heated above their recrystallization point to circumvent strain hardening during deformation. The heated material is then plastically molded and shaped in molds, which can also be preheated if necessary. This high-temperature setting facilitates the crafting of more complex shapes than cold forging, enhancing the metal's malleability and moldability.

For superalloys, which are inherently less pliable, specialized methods such as isothermal forging are employed to avert oxidation. This process, akin to hot forging, maintains the workpiece at an optimal thermal state throughout, guaranteeing exceptional quality and structural integrity in the finished product.

Preserving the workpiece's temperature is accomplished by heating the mold to a level close to or slightly below the workpiece's temperature. This prevents cooling at mold interfaces, thereby optimizing metal flow characteristics and boosting forming precision.
